What should you check out if you have a black screen on Vivo Z1

Before embarking on the tricks, we suggest you to examine the things below to be able to better understand where the problem can originate. This will give you good clues of the nature of the problem.

Is the Vivo Z1 LED on when the display screen remains black?

One of the first points to examine is the tiny led that is on top of your display screen. In cases where the LED is red or blue when the Vivo Z1 display screen remains black, it signifies that the cellphone is started. In such cases, it is very likely that the problem originates from the display screen.

Is the Vivo Z1 charged?

Sometimes, a deep battery discharge prevents the Vivo Z1 from turning on for some time. Make sure the Vivo Z1 is totally charged by leaving it connected for at least one hour. In the event that after this the LED does not light up and the display screen stays black, the problem can probably result from the battery.

Is the Vivo Z1 damaged?

If the Vivo Z1 display screen remains black after shock, after dropping , after being wet , or after damage , the screen may well be broken. In such cases, not one of the tips listed below will function. You will then have to bring your Vivo Z1 to a repairman.

What to do when the Vivo Z1 screen stays black?

After looking at that the problem comes from the display screen, you can try the next tips to unlock the black display screen of your Vivo Z1. If a trick does not function, look at the following one.

Plug the Vivo Z1 into its charger

The first thing to do when the display screen of Vivo Z1 remains black is to put the telephone on. This will make it feasible to be peaceful for all subsequent manipulations. This also handles the possible problem of a deep discharge of the telephone battery.

If possible, remove the battery from the Vivo Z1

If the Vivo Z1 is easily removable, we suggest you to remove the battery . This from time to time handles the black display screen problem. Hold out a few seconds, then turn the battery back on and make an attempt to start the telephone. If perhaps the display screen is still blocked, look at the following step.

Remove SIM card and SD card

It from time to time happens, without explanation, that the SIM card or the SD card conflicts with Vivo Z1 and triggers a black display screen. 1 of the tips to try is to remove the SIM card and the SD card. When it’s performed, you should try to start the phone. If perhaps it works, it means there is a conflict with the SIM or SD card.

Force Vivo Z1 to reboot

If the display screen stays black, the problem often solves with a forced reboot . To achieve this, you will need to press several keys at the same time.
